Laser hair removal can be an effective method to remove unwanted hair long-term. However, individuals with dark skin often face unique challenges when seeking this treatment. It's essential to understand the specific considerations connected with laser hair removal for dark skin tones to achieve optimal results and minimize the risk of complications.
A key factor to remember is that darker skin contains more melanin, the pigment responsible for skin color. During laser hair removal, the laser targets melanin in the hair follicle to eliminate it. In individuals with dark skin, there's a higher risk of lightening due to the increased melanin content.
To minimize this risk, it is crucial to choose a qualified and experienced dermatologist who specializes in treating various skin types. They will be able to recommend the appropriate laser system and settings for your specific skin tone. Furthermore, following pre- and post-treatment instructions carefully is essential for enhancing results and minimizing potential side effects.
It's also important to book a consultation with your dermatologist to assess your medical history, skin type, and treatment goals. They can provide personalized advice on how to safely and effectively attain your desired hair removal results while maintaining the health and integrity of your skin.
Best and Successful Laser Hair Removal for Deeper Complexions
Laser hair removal can be a remarkable solution for individuals with darker complexions who desire smooth skin. Traditionally, laser treatments have been restricted by their effectiveness on deeper skin tones due to the chance of discoloration.
However, modern advancements in laser technology have drastically refined the safety and effectiveness of treatment for multiple skin types, including those with deeper complexions.
These new lasers employ longer wavelengths that identify pigment more effectively without causing undue harm to the surrounding skin.
It's important to consult with a qualified dermatologist or laser hair removal specialist who is well-versed in treating multiple skin types, particularly deeper complexions. They can evaluate your individual complexion and suggest the most appropriate laser treatment plan for you.

Expert Tips for Successful Laser Hair Removal on Dark Skin
Achieving vibrant results from laser hair removal can be particularly rewarding on darker skin tones. While the benefits are undeniable, understanding your individual needs is crucial for a successful and safe experience.
Firstly, selecting the ideal laser technology is paramount. Opt for lasers with adjustable settings that can effectively target melanin while minimizing discomfort. A consultation with a qualified dermatologist or technician specializing in dark skin tones is highly suggested.
They will help determine the optimal wavelength, pulse duration, and energy levels for your complexion.
Before treatment, it's essential to reduce sun exposure and tanning booths as this can increase sensitivity of complications.
Pre-treatment your session involves using a gentle exfoliating routine to remove dead skin cells and ensure optimal laser absorption.
On the day of treatment, apply sunscreen with at least SPF30 to protect your surface. Be prepared for some tingling sensations during the procedure, which are usually manageable with built-in cooling systems.
Post-treatment care is just as essential as the treatment itself. Use a cool compress to soothe any inflammation and continue using sunscreen daily.
Avoid excessive activities and friction against your treated area for a few days.
Patience is key, as multiple sessions are typically required for optimal results.
Follow your practitioner's guidelines closely and don't hesitate to communicate any concerns or questions you may have throughout the process. With proper care and attention, laser hair removal can be a safe solution for achieving long-lasting, hair-free skin on dark tones.
